Strong investor relations help build and maintain investor trust and confidence by ensuring open communication about the firm's performance, strategy, and even potential risks. Trust is especially important in private equity, where investments are often illiquid and require a long-term commitment.
Investor relations (or IR) is a specific sub-discipline of public relations that revolves around how a company communicates with investors, shareholders, government authorities and the financial community.
Let's keep it simple: Investor relations, or IR for short, is a communications specialty that focuses on helping publicly traded companies get their stories out to Wall Street, including shareholders, potential investors and the broader financial community.
Effective communication, conflict resolution, and stakeholder management skills are vital because they enable IR professionals to build and maintain positive relationships. IROs should first aim to fine-tune their communication skills.
In some companies, investor relations is managed by the public relations or corporate communications departments, and can also be referred to as "financial public relations" or "financial communications." In smaller companies, the IR function is often outsourced to independent investor relations firms.
Nowadays the IR function not only covers activities such as information disclosure, coordinating meetings with shareholders and analysts, and evaluating market responses to corporate performance, but it aims to create a long-term interaction with current and potential stakeholders in the capital market.
Investor relations managers have the responsibility of managing communication between a company's corporate management and its investors. They help to support releasing information, handling inquiries and meetings, and providing feedback to management and crisis management.
